[Update] Ian Howlett tells us that the Nintendo 3DS, so far, is a no-show at the event. It is, however, still being advertised in all promotional material for the three-day event.

[Original] Beginning tonight and running until Sunday, Toronto will welcome gamers and fans of comics, sci-fi franchises and more to its annual multigenre fan convention, dubbed FanExpo.

The gaming "section" of the event--held at the Metro Toronto Convention Centre in the heart of Canada's largest city--is set to feature Sony's PlayStation Move, Microsoft's Kinect and the upcoming "glasses-free" handheld from Nintendo, the 3DS. [See update]

Additionally, fans will have a chance to meet nerd darling Felicia Day, Video Games Live co-founder Tommy Tallarico, Weekend Confirmed co-host Jeff Cannata, and legendary Final Fantasy artist Yoshitaka Amano.
